As with regular monthly leases, all details regarding deposits and additional fees must be contained in the lease. For vacation rentals, added charges that are common may originate from hotel taxes and cleaning fees. Additional charges can also be incurred at the property for other people or pets, stays beyond the checkout time, property damage and telephone use. A damage deposit or reservation deposit is a lease requirement to hold the property. Terms for the return of a damage deposit should be spelled out. Full payment for the vacation rental is required before the arrival date--sometimes up to 30 days before check-in.

Be careful not to price yourself out of the market, when you establish the rent for your apartment that is furnished. If you establish the rent too high, you may not have the ability to lease the apartment to anyone. If you're concerned about your furnishings, you might be better off keep or to sell them and lease the apartment unfurnished. In general, you should establish the rent based on your own expenses to possess and preserve the property, including the furnishings, plus your desired rate of return in your investment. For instance, if it costs you $15,000 per year to own and maintain the property, and you need to make $5,000 per year on the property, the annual rent should be $20,000, or month. about $1,675 per Compare that cost to charge rent that'll match your needs, taking into account furnishings and the features of your property, and other rents in the area still be competitive.

To protect your investment when letting a furnished flat, it is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the items contained in the apartment lease. Be really particular; record the amount of plates, bowls, and cups, for instance, and describe items as accurately as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if it is damaged beyond normal wear and tear, or if the piece is taken by the renter with him when he moves out. Indicate if the renter will must pay you directly for the things, or if the replacement cost will be required out of the security deposit. Have so there are not any surprises when the lease comes to a finish the tenant sign a copy of this inventory.

If you lease a house or flat that's furnished, whether it includes just some basic furniture or is fully furnished with furniture, linens, electronic equipment, and accessories, you can bill renters rent that is higher. You'd to buy the things which are furnishing the house, and will need to replace those things if they're damaged or destroyed. A monthly rent that is higher will recoup those costs. It's up to you as the landlord to determine how much more you want to bill for the furnishings, but usually the increased price will be based by owners on the state and style of the furnishings. For instance, a property that features a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that comprises mismatched pieces with frayed seams.

In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ished flat, you could ask for a higher security deposit on the lease. Collecting more cash up front can help you cover the costs of repairing or replacing the items in the furnished flat if they are damaged. Check with your state laws before collecting the security deposit, though. Some states have laws controlling security deposits and what landlords can charge. If you do not want to contain it in the security deposit, you could also charge another cleaning fee for the lease, to cover the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, curtains and other things.

Any service that incurs a fee should be contained in the lease, including phone use,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Sometimes, discretionary services are accessible, like daily housekeeping services along with cleaning upon departure. These should be, at the absolute minimum, listed on the lease in case the vacationers choose to make use of the service after they arrive. Anticipations about the use of the property should also be clearly indicated in the lease or via a procedures guide refer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es the garbage out and where does it go? Should the sheets be stripped housekeeping or by by the vacationers?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? These are all problems that should be addressed prevent conflicts over the stay and the lease and to ensure a smooth holiday.

Times and the dates of departure and arrival are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ned between stays. To avert vacancy between stays, the time between check in and checkout is normally a relatively brief window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are occasionally last minute requests to arrive or depart late or early. It is, thus, crucial that you contain eventuality requests in the lease, suggesting both a procedure and a price to change agreed upon strategies.
